A vital and poetic reimagening of an ancient text Grendel's Mother, inspired by the famed Anglo-Saxon epic poem, Beowulf, gives voice to the monster's mother. Gardner tells the story in verse, blending the ancient form of epic narrative poetry with modern forms. The poems evoke the images of proud bearded warriors, the music of psalteries and the laughter in the mead halls against the sound of the ocean. But they also probe the meaning of female monstrousness and the struggles of women in the harsh world of our ancestors.
